I'm trying to burn a CD on my notebook, but with no success....
What I've done (following the
document/usr/share/doc/cdrecord/README.ATAPI.setup) :
/etc/lilo.conf --> append="hdc=ide-scsi max_scsi_luns=1"
modprobe ide-scsi sg
<snip>
cdrecord: Warning: Running on Linux-2.6.13
<snip>
As result, the CD is unusable and I'm frustrated. I'm using the same
procedure I use on my desktop.
As you're using kernel 2.6, you longer need to use ide-scsi emulation,
remove the append line from your lilo config and burn a cd with
$ cdrecord dev=/dev/hdc image.iso
